 Ata Rangi makes the most revered Pinot Noir in New Zealand. You’d be hard-pressed to find a list of Best New Zealand Pinot Noir that does not feature Ata Rangi at the top of the list. 2016 Ata Rangi Pinot is yet another stunning effort from Clive Paton and the winemaker Helen Masters.

The fabled Adel clone is the back-bone of this wine (up to 40%), allegedly smuggled from Burgundy in the mid-70’s, together with only the oldest parcels of fruit.

 The wine is very complex, structured, beautifully perfumed in the classic Ata Rangi style. Exotic spice of star anise with dark cherry and rose petal on the nose. The palate is bright, fluid and focused. Fine tannins build through the mid -palate carrying the wine to a long elegant finish.


Moderately deep ruby-red colour, lighter on the rim with purple hues. The nose is elegantly proportioned with taut and tightly bound aromas of ripe black cherry and black berried fruits entwined with savoury dark herbs, revealing complexing nuances of undergrowth and minerals, unveiling some whole bunch stalk perfumes. This has refined and serious detail. Medium-bodied, the palate has rich, sweet and succulently vibrant flavours of black cherries and black berried fruits melded with savoury dark herbs, complex whole bunch stalk elements, unfolding subtle notes of violet florals and minerals. The fruit possesses great vitality and energy, and is supported by plenty of fine-grained, flowery tannin extraction, with gently refreshing, lacy acidity. The palate has wonderful concentration and linearity and the wine carries with real drive to a very long and sustained finish of black fruits, savoury dark herbs and whole bunch nuances.

This is a superbly concentrated Pinot Noir possessing flavours of Abel clone influenced black fruits, savoury dark herbs and complex whole bunch notes on a refined and well-structured palate with immense vitality. Match with slow-cooked game meat dishes over the next 8-10+ years.A blend of clones, approx. 40% Abel, with 5, Dijon clones and 10/5 from the company’s oldest vines, indigenous yeast fermented with 30% whole clusters to 13.0% alc., the wine spending 20-26 days on skins and aged 11 months in 35% new French oak, blended, and then held for a further 6 months.

19.5/20 points  Raymond Chan


This has all the cherry and spice and perfume that defines this consistently stunning pinot noir, as well as a sense of immense freshness. The palate has deceptive lightness and tannins that are supple and caressing and that kick fresh and expansive out through the finish. Succulent and elegant. A great vintage for this wine. Drink now. Screw cap.

98 points James Suckling   Top100 Wines Of 2017


Elegant, supple and very vibrant pinot noir, with seductively-layered floral, red rose, cherry, red fruits, dried herb and mixed spice flavours. Very long and linear wine that demonstrated real power delivered with great subtlety. A wonderfully pure pinot noir with a distinctive house/vineyard style and a proven ability to age graciously 4/6/2018 Drink 2018 to 2030
